Thus legally, people who quit their jobs voluntarily or get fired are not eligible to apply for these benefits. SUI covers only those who are not responsible for becoming unemployed. Most SUI rates range from 0.5% to 4.1%, although some go up to 11% depending on the state and length of time the employer has been in business. For instance, once you pass the new employer phase, your state will assign you an updated rate within a given range. For example — Alabama has a SUTA tax rate range of 0.65% to 6.8% for 2023. Some states go the extra mile by categorizing new employer rates based on industry type — construction and non-construction, for instance.

Generally, only employees who are laid off or lose available work are eligible for unemployment benefits. Those who voluntarily quit or are fired for misconduct don’t receive these benefits unless their what is the right time to buy bitcoin situation meets the state’s conditions. However, companies can challenge an unemployment claim if they believe the former employee is ineligible or provided inaccurate information.
